## Break-Glass: Stockpilot Restock Planner

Scope: emergency access to the Stockpilot scheduling DB when the planner halts mid-route and machines go unstocked. Invoke only if both Renn and Odalys are unreachable. Steps: announce in the incident channel, snapshot the DB, restart the route solver, verify the Halverton depot queue drains. Access is audited; expect a follow-up review at the next sync. Unlock the emergency credentials with the passphrase below.

unlock words, fawif-hahip: eliax-ulador-holdor-novix-prawyn-norius-kelax-weniel-alddor-ulaion

Handover — dependency pinning, Lattivo API. Policy as of this week: all direct deps pinned exact, transitive deps locked via the resolver file, no ranges anywhere. Renovate-style bumps go through Marek's review queue; do not merge auto-PRs on Fridays. If a CVE forces an unpinned hotfix, pin it back within 24h and note it in the ledger. Builds fail closed on lockfile mismatch — don't override. The current pins are reflected in the config below.

config for haweg-bagag:
[kasath]
host = kasath.qirvancorp.internal
user = kasath_svc
database = kasath_prod

## Changelog — Font vendoring defaults changed

As of this release, the Bracken UI build no longer fetches third-party fonts at build time. All typefaces used by the Lanternwell suite are now vendored into the repo under a dedicated assets directory, and the fetch step is skipped by default. If you're onboarding, nothing to install — the fonts travel with the checkout. The build flags controlling this behavior are listed below.

settings of hadup-yafog:
LAMAEL_PIN=3761
LAMAEL_TENANT=istmir
LAMAEL_METRICS_HOST=metrics.lamael.plorvasys.test
LAMAEL_SEAL=seal_8ea68500
LAMAEL_STANDBY_TEAM=fraok

Handover: cron drift on Pellwick's batch tier. I traced the drift to the scheduler node syncing against a stale NTP pool after the Varnholt migration; offsets grew roughly 40ms per hour until jobs fired outside their lock window. I pinned chrony to the internal source and added a drift alarm at 250ms. Please review the alarm thresholds carefully before merge. To unlock the staging vault for verification, use the recovery passphrase below.

vault phrase of fawif-haduf = wenwyn-briath